    Time value of money. The present value of $1,000, 100 years into the future. Curves represent constant discount rates of 2%, 3%, 5%, and 7%. The time value of money refers to the fact that there is normally a greater benefit to receiving a sum of money now rather than an identical sum later.     Net present value. The net present value (NPV) or net present worth (NPW) [1] is a way of measuring the value of an asset that has cashflow by adding up the present value of all the future cash flows that asset will generate.     Dividend discount model. In financial economics, the dividend discount model (DDM) is a method of valuing the price of a company's capital stock or business value based on the assertion that intrinsic value is determined by the sum of future cash flows from dividend payments to shareholders, discounted back to their present value.
